Abstract

本发明公开了一种螺母带支撑结构的循环球转向器,包含一壳体,所述的壳体内设有一转向螺杆和一摇臂轴,所述的转向螺杆上设有一可活动的转向螺母,所述的转向螺杆的末端设有一轴承和一盖板,所述的壳体内设有一圆筒状的转动腔,所述的转向螺母包含一块状的转向主体,所述的转向主体的中心设有一贯穿的转向螺筒,所述的转向主体的顶部设有一弧形的支撑弧面,所述的支撑弧面上设有一对弧形的支撑弧条。一旦转向螺杆受弯矩和转矩作用,由于转向螺母的顶部的支撑弧条抵住转动腔的内壁,转向螺杆得到有效支撑,大大提高了转向螺杆可以承受的最大输入扭矩,可以搭载更大前轴负荷的车型。

The invention discloses a recirculating ball steering gear with a nut with a supporting structure, comprising a casing, a steering screw rod and a rocker arm shaft are arranged in the casing, and a movable steering nut is arranged on the steering screw rod, The end of the steering screw is provided with a bearing and a cover plate, the housing is provided with a cylindrical rotating cavity, the steering nut includes a one-piece steering body, and the center of the steering body is set. There is a through steering screw barrel, the top of the steering main body is provided with an arc-shaped supporting arc surface, and the supporting arc surface is provided with a pair of arc-shaped supporting arc bars. Once the steering screw is subjected to bending moment and torque, since the supporting arc on the top of the steering nut is against the inner wall of the rotating cavity, the steering screw is effectively supported, which greatly increases the maximum input torque that the steering screw can bear, and can be equipped with a larger front Axle load models.

Background technique
The steering screw of existing ball-and-nut steering gear can be deformed under the action of bending moment and torque, lead to steel ball Discontinuity in raceway, therefore the input torque value that diverter can be born is smaller.As shown in figure 9, existing circulating ball There are gap K between steering nut 6S and shell 1S on the steering screw 3S of diverter, once steering screw 3S is deformed, Steering nut 6S cannot get any support.

Specific embodiment
The preferred embodiment of the present invention is described in detail with reference to the accompanying drawing, so that advantages and features of the invention energy It is easier to be readily appreciated by one skilled in the art, so as to make a clearer definition of the protection scope of the present invention.
As shown in Figures 1 to 6, ball-and-nut steering gear of the nut with support construction includes a shell 1, is set in the shell 1 There are a steering screw 3 and a rocker arm shaft 2, which is equipped with a mobilizable steering nut 6, the end of the steering screw 3 End is equipped with a bearing 4 and a cover board 5, and a cylindric rotation chamber 100 is equipped in the shell 1, which includes one blocky Steering main body 60, the center of the steering main body 60 is equipped with a perforative steering barrel 61, and the top of the steering main body 60 is equipped with The support cambered surface 62 of one arc, the support cambered surface 62 are equipped with the supporting arc item 621 of a pair of of arc, the arc of the supporting arc item 621 The arc radius of the inner wall of radius and the rotation chamber 100 is adapted, and it is flat that the two sides of the steering main body 60 are respectively equipped with a steering Face 63, wherein one turns to plane 63 equipped with several mounting holes 631 for this, which is equipped with a dismountable steel ball and leads Pipe fitting 7.
The steel ball cannula member 7 includes a vessel clamp 71 and a pair of of conduit 72, which includes the arc of a pair of of arc Groove 711 and several fixing threaded holes 712, the radius of the radian of the arc groove 711 and the conduit 72 are adapted.
As shown in Figure 7 and Figure 8, once 3 bending moment of steering screw and torque, due to the branch at the top of steering nut 6 Support arc item 621 resists the inner wall of rotation chamber 100, and steering screw 3 is effectively supported, and substantially increasing steering screw 3 can hold The maximum input torque received can carry the vehicle of bigger preceding thrust load.
In addition, avoiding steering nut 6 because of steering screw 3 since the side of steering nut 6 is arranged in steel ball cannula member 7 Deformation and cause to damage.And steering screw in the prior art, it is generally arranged at the top of steering nut, is easy to be squeezed And deformation occurs.
